Re: 4 th main bearing cap
Mark, when I sent my rear 4th bearing support to have new babbit poured, I was requested to include the drive plate shaft, so it could be machined and the babbit poured to match the shaft size. Without the shaft, there is no guarantee that it won’t be too loose or too tight. Jim Patrick
